Given fractions are 2825/789,4684/3334
To find the GCF of fractions, we have to find the GCF of numerator numbers and LCM of denominator numbers. Its formula is given by
GCF of Fraction = Greatest Common Factor of Numerator/Least Common Multiple of Denominators
In the fractions 2825/789,4684/3334, numerators are 2825,4684
Denominators are 789,3334
The GCF of 2825,4684 is 1 .
LCM of 789,3334 is 2630526.
The greatest common factor of 2825/789,4684/3334 = [GCF of 2825,4684]/[LCM of 789,3334]= 1/2630526
Therefore, the GCF of 2825/789,4684/3334 is 1/2630526.

2. What is the GCF of a fraction?
The GCF of a fraction is defined as the greatest fraction that divides exactly into 2 or more fractions.
3. How to find GCF in Fractions?
Answer: GCF of fractions can be found using the simple formula GCF of Fractions = GCF of Numerators/LCM of Denominators.
